Transaction 3d374dcbf2333e8b1015eae080f9b70c6608f99807bb13fed0832c17d79edaa9
1 Input
1 Output
-
3d374dcbf2333e8b1015eae080f9b70c6608f99807bb13fed0832c17d79edaa9:0
- value
- 19992520
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fc0b9bbeba118fa5565d16867ad5cbc749d49a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16p6Stb96b6UE8UG7zd4mSNgiU2t1PhbDK